Retatrutide Is More Than a Single GLP-1 Compound

Retatrutide is often grouped with GLP-1 peptides because GLP-1 receptor activity forms part of its research profile.

However, the compound is also investigated in relation to GIP and glucagon receptor pathways. Its scientific context is therefore broader than that of a conventional single-pathway GLP-1 agonist.

This triple-receptor structure can influence study design. A laboratory investigating one receptor independently may require a different assay from a project examining combined pathway behaviour.

The wider receptor profile should not be interpreted as proof that Retatrutide is more effective or more clinically valuable than another compound. It is a scientific characteristic that defines the type of research questions the material may support.

Designing Triple-Agonist Research

Retatrutide research may involve receptor activation, comparative pathway behaviour, signalling interactions or other controlled scientific questions.

A useful study should identify whether the laboratory intends to examine GLP-1, GIP and glucagon receptor activity independently or within a combined model.

The selected assay must be capable of answering the intended question. A single-receptor system may not provide enough information for a study focused on triple-pathway interactions.

Controls should also be relevant to the model. These may include untreated conditions, reference compounds or pathway-specific comparators where scientifically appropriate.

Primary outcomes should be defined before data collection begins. Exploratory findings may add useful context, but they should not be presented as though they were prespecified conclusions.

Published Research and Reta Pen Products

Published clinical research can provide scientific background on Retatrutide, but it must remain separate from product claims.

Clinical trials use defined investigational formulations, approved protocols and regulated participant monitoring. A separately supplied laboratory research pen does not automatically have the same formulation, legal status or clinical evidence.

This means published outcomes should not be used to promise results for Reta Pen 20mg or Reta Pen 40mg.

Analytical Documentation and Third-Party Testing

Analytical documentation may help laboratories review a Reta pen product before ordering.

Where Janoshik or another independent laboratory has tested a submitted sample, the associated report may provide information about that sample under the method used.

Researchers should verify that the report relates to the correct product and submitted sample. Documentation associated with one Reta format should not automatically be assumed to apply to every current vial or pen.

The analytical method also has limits. HPLC, for example, may provide composition-related information under defined conditions, but it does not prove every aspect of identity, stability, biological activity or clinical performance.

General landing-page text should not reproduce exact purity percentages or specific batch numbers. Those details belong within the current report.
